Paralegal - Trust & Estates The candidate will be responsible for assisting attorneys, other paralegals and firm members with all aspects of estate planning and trust administration work in a team-oriented practice group. Organizing and analyzing asset information. Preparing of inventories, asset allocation agreements, asset transfer documents, and Judicial Council forms. Researching and drafting grant deeds, trust transfer deeds, and supporting documents. Drafting probate pleadings, including fiduciary reports/accountings, Spousal Property petitions, Heggstad petitions, etc.. Assisting with Estate and Gift Tax return preparation. Maintaining checkbooks and banking records; paying bills, and computing and disbursing beneficiary distributions; computing and payment of executor and trustee commissions; preparation of formal and informal estate and trust accountings; Marshalling assets and arranging for valuation as necessary. Probate Court practice responsibilities include: Reading and interpreting Wills and trust instruments; prepare and file all documents required for probate wills; prepare receipt and release agreements, disclaimers, affidavits, accounting petitions; handle issuance and revocation of letters and other miscellaneous proceedings, including preparation of petitions and overseeing service on interested parties. Should have 5+ years of paralegal experience in Trust & Estates and probate administration, preferably in a law firm. Paralegal Certification from an approved program is preferred.
